Senior Market Research Manager - Top 4 Consulting firm

Job description

This role sits in a Top 4 Consulting Firm within a large, successful consumer insights and experience design practice.
  
You’ll work on some of the most challenging and interesting research projects around for commercial and government clients, as well as flagship global pieces of thought leadership and large transformation projects.
  
Critically, being part of a multi-disciplinary consulting firm means you will have access and exposure to wider business units to learn things and apply your end-to-end insights skills in new and alternative ways - organisation, marketing, strategy, operations, technology, transformations, mergers & acquisitions, digital and advanced analytics, across industries and geographies.
  
Key responsibilities and projects:
  • Delivering quantitative and qualitative research studies through the whole project lifecycle
  • A mix of meaningful social research projects for State and Federal Government clients
  • Very sharp, strategic, and stretchy commercial briefs for large Services and Retail brands
  • Developing client ready materials
  • Leading and mentoring people, fostering an innovative and inclusive culture
  • Working with different data sets to drive actionable strategies
  • Working on client proposals to help win and build accounts
  • Building strong client and stakeholder relationships across the business
  • Projects include; customer experience, segmentations, journey mapping, big U&A, behavioural science, branding, reputation, community impact, policy evaluation.
  • Vision to become a future leader in the business
  Key skills:
  • Significant research and insights experience, preferably in a research agency or consultancy
  • Broad methodological experience in quantitative research design
  • Experienced in qualitative methodologies like IDIs
  • Strong analytical, interpretation and writing skills
  • Sharp skills in transforming insights into business strategy
  • An influential presentation style
  • Experienced with stats packages like SPSS/Q
  • Experience in mentoring and supporting others
